Abstract: | The viscosities of the mixtures 1-hexyl-3-methylimidazolium hexafluorophosphate (HMIM]PF6]) + CO2 and 1-octyl-3-methylimidazolium hexafluorophosphate (OMIM]PF6]) + CO2 were measured with a rolling ball viscometer. The CO2 mole fraction for one mixture ranged up to 0.434 and the other up to 0.447. The viscosities were measured at 293.15-353.15 K and 10-20.0 MPa. The experimental uncertainty in viscosity was estimated to be within ±3.0%. The experimental data were compared with McAllister's three-body model, which correlated with the experimental data within average absolute deviations of 5.9%. |
